+Chrome Early Loading Framework (aka ChromeELF)
+
+chrome_elf.dll is shipped in Chrome's version directory to ease updates,
+and is loaded early in chrome.exe's lifetime. This is done by turning the
+version directory into a private assembly which refers to chrome_elf.dll
+(http://msdn.microsoft.com/library/aa374224.aspx).
+
+In an ideal world, this would be done by embedding an application config in
+chrome.exe that would refer to the proper version directory via a
+probing\privatePath attribute (http://msdn.microsoft.com/library/aa374182.aspx).
+This would allow us to refer to dlls in the version directory without having to
+make the version directory itself into an assembly. It would also avoid naming
+conflicts (as the WinSxS cache may override the lookup path from a private
